About Insh

Insh is a small village situated in the Highland region of Scotland, within the postcode area PH21. It is located near the banks of the River Spey, which is well-known for its fishing opportunities. The village offers a peaceful atmosphere and is surrounded by the natural beauty of the Scottish landscape, making it a suitable spot for outdoor activities such as walking and cycling.

The area is also close to the Cairngorms National Park, providing access to various trails and scenic views. Insh has a small community, with local amenities that cater to residents and visitors alike. The nearby village of Aviemore, just a short drive away, offers additional facilities, including shops and restaurants, enhancing the experience for those who choose to visit the region.
